Abstract

The utility model discloses a cloth sticking device of a printing machine, wherein a cloth sticking roller is pulled down by a cylinder to be contacted with a conveying belt, a driving-roller chain wheel is driven by a cloth sticking motor to clockwise rotate, the cloth sticking roller is driven by an upper chain to leftwards move along a guide-rail rod, and woven cloth is clung to the conveying belt. When a travel-switch contact block touches the travel switch of a clutch, a lower chain is driven by the output shaft of the clutch to clockwise rotate, the cloth sticking roller is driven by the lower chain to rightwards move, the cloth sticking motor does not work at the time, the cloth sticking motor works again after the cloth sticking roller moves to a set time, the output shaft of the clutch is in a power separating state with a large roller barrel, and the cloth sticking roller leftwards moves under the driving of the cloth sticking motor, back and forth, again and again. The cloth sticking roller is a steam heating roller, the temperature is uniform and constant, the bonding effect of the woven cloth and the conveying belt is good, and the utility model is favorable to improving the printing quality of products.

Technical field
The utility model relates to the dyeing apparatus technical field, more specifically to a kind of fabric sticking device of the flat screen printing machine of weaving cotton cloth.
Background technology
The fabric sticking device of the existing flat screen printing machine of weaving cotton cloth generally adopts the electro heat pressure roller, and its weak point is: 1, adopt the electro heat pressure roller, non-uniform temperature on the electric heating pressure roller roll surface influences adhesive effect, simultaneously, easily the belt conveyor with viscose glue is burnt out.2, electric heating roller can't rotate with belt conveyor, make weave cotton cloth with belt conveyor on viscose glue bonding smooth inadequately.
The utility model content
At the deficiency that above-mentioned prior art exists, the purpose of this utility model provides a kind of fabric sticking device of printing machine, and its patch roller is a steam roll, and temperature is evenly constant, and it is good with the belt conveyor adhesive effect to weave cotton cloth, and helps improving the product printing quality.

Principle of work: spindle nose 32 connects the cyclic steam pipeline, is connected with steam in the patch roller 3, makes that patch roller 3 surface temperatures are even, like this when weave cotton cloth with belt conveyor 2 on viscose glue when bonding, be subjected to temperature constant, adhesive effect is good, and is very useful to printing quality.
Patch roller 3 is with piston 61 1 liftings of cylinder 6, realizes and presses belt conveyor 2 and separate two actions with belt conveyor 2, and when not needing cylinder 6 pressing belt conveyor 2, cylinder 6 makes patch roller 3 separate with belt conveyor 2, and can not burn out belt conveyor 2 like this.During patch simultaneously, the pressure of cylinder 6 has been arranged, weave cotton cloth with viscose glue fit tightr, simultaneously cylinder under the driving of patch roll driving apparatus 7 back and forth backward extruding weave cotton cloth and belt conveyor 2, make the surface of weaving cotton cloth bonding more smooth with viscose glue.
